For many music lovers, "Can't Stop" instantly brings to mind the iconic Red Hot Chili Peppers. Their 2002 track, a standout from the album By the Way, is a prime example of their signature funk-rock energy, even if it's considered one of the album's less overtly funky moments. It's a song that became a staple in their live sets, a testament to its enduring appeal. Interestingly, this track even found its way into the visually striking world of Love, Death & Robots, adding another layer to its cultural footprint.

But the Red Hot Chili Peppers aren't the only ones to claim this title. Dive into the vibrant world of K-Pop, and you'll find TOMORROW X TOGETHER lending their voices to the OST for Brewing Love with a track also called "Can't Stop." This version, released in late 2024, offers a different sonic landscape, showcasing the versatility of the phrase in contemporary music.

Then there's the youthful energy of Chinese hip-hop group BOY STORY, whose 2017 single "Can't Stop" embodies the spirit of their "REAL! PROJECT." This track, with its blend of hip-hop beats and percussive elements, speaks to the experiences of young people navigating their lives and aspirations.

And let's not forget the rock anthems. South Korean band CNBLUE released their fifth mini-album, also titled Can't Stop, in 2014. This collection of songs, entirely self-written by the members, earned critical acclaim, even snagging the Best Rock award at the Melon Music Awards. The title itself, as the band explained, signifies their unwavering commitment to their musical journey.
